SECOND CHANCES
Then the Word of the Lord came a second time. I think second chances and God’s forgiveness are the core of the book of Jonah. Jonah did all that he could to run from God’s call, but God didn’t give up on him. Nineveh, too, had done so much, yet God’s will was and is to forgive. God refused to give up on Jonah or Nineveh. He doesn’t give up on us either. No matter where we are and where we have been, God is still calling us.
Here are some highlights from today’s video:
- The Word of the Lord came a second time.
- God refused to give up on Nineveh and on Jonah. He doesn’t give up on us either.
- Jonah shares the story of a prophet with a hard heart and sinners with soft hearts.
- Jonah Chapter 3, Verse 5 (ESV): The people repented.
- Repentance is more than just words. In Jonah Chapter 3, Verse 8 (ESV), it says Let everyone TURN from his evil way.
- God didn’t just hear their apology; He could see their repentance. (Jonah 3:10 ESV)

About this Plan

Jonah is one of my favorite Bible stories. It's a small and rich story with only four small chapters; it doesn’t take long, but it is filled with powerful lessons for us today. We are going to spend four days reading through the book of Jonah together, pulling lessons from the life and story of Jonah.
